December 24, 2025 – The Christmas Light that Restores the Soul

John 1:4

Sermon: 1895 Jesus, the Light of the World, part 1

Pray Over This

“In Him was life, and the life was the light of men.”

John 1:4

Ponder This

When you think about Jesus as the Light of the world, you see His constancy. There’s one thing about light: It is constant. The first two verses of John tell us, “In the beginning was the Word, and the Word was with God, and the Word was God.” Now Jesus is God, and being God, He never changes. God cannot change. How could God change? He couldn’t get better, and He won’t get worse. He’s unchangeable. He says, “I’m the Lord. I change not.” Light is constant. Light does not change.

I heard a preacher say, “You can’t make God nervous.” I love that. There’s no panic in Heaven. He does not change, and He sees the beginning from the end. When Jesus came into the world, in Him was life, and that life was the light of Man! That’s the vitality of this life. You want your life put back together? It’ll be put back together with light. There is a divine photosynthesis when Jesus brings light to your life. Your cold, dark, dead, clammy world will be put back together when the glorious light of the Son of God shines into your heart. Thank God there is a sunrise for the soul.

  • How has Jesus been a light in your life?
  • What are some ways you have seen Jesus’ light through other people? How did that impact you?

 

Practice This

Recall and reflect upon a testimony from someone else about how Jesus has changed that person’s life.
